Running a massive steel train at 200 miles per hour requires an enormous amount of continuous electrical power. Delivering that power means dragging a metal arm (the pantograph) across a live, high-voltage overhead wire. At those incredible speeds, the aerodynamic bouncing and intense physical friction should instantly shatter the arm or melt the wire. The only thing preventing this is the extreme tribology of the contact [...] book breaks down the material engineering of the high-speed rail interface. The contact strip must be highly electrically conductive, incredibly heat-resistant, and provide their own dry lubrication. Modern rail networks rely on hyper-engineered carbon-graphite alloys. We explore the mechanical dynamics of maintaining perfectly balanced upward pressure on the overhead line-if the pressure is too low, the connection breaks and creates a destructive, 10,000-degree electrical arc; if the pressure is too high, the wire [...] detail the relentless maintenance and metallurgical innovations required by the Shinkansen and TGV networks to keep this single, fragile point of contact intact through rain, ice, and supersonic aerodynamic drag.Understand the most stressed piece of metal in transportation. A deep dive into the brutal physics of dragging power out of the sky at three hundred kilometers per hour.
